HBW 002: From Hobby to Full-Time Business for a Stay At Home Mom with LaShanda Henry

October 5, 2015 | By Rosetta |

happy black woman podcast_feat _LaShanda Henry_capitals_72dpi

LaShanda Henry has been developing websites for over 10 years. She owns over 15 web properties and is most passionate about two things: creating positive websites for people of color and helping women entrepreneurs learn how to build successful businesses online. In her own words, “My life’s mission is to motivate, inform, inspire, and connect. With my mother in mind, I do what I do for parents looking to better their children’s lives and for women striving to live their dreams. I love to share information and build communities online. It’s what I do and who I am.” LaShanda is Rosetta’s guest on this episode of Happy Black Woman, so grab a drink and a notepad and come meet this amazing woman!

On a mission to use technology as a tool of positive change!

LaShanda Henry is on a mission to use technology within the black community online and at home. She’s a work at home mom with a passion for building websites and helping other women like me make sense of making money online. She’s done it herself and knows how to help others do it too. One look at her website, www.SistaSense.com shows you that she’s got a TON to offer. Listen in to this casual conversation between LaShanda and Rosetta as they discuss LaShanda’s story, technology, productivity, and why every black woman can step beyond where she’s at to open up new doors of opportunity, if she’ll just do it. LaShanda’s story is not all that uncommon. LIke many online entrepreneurs, her present business didn’t start out as a “business” at all. At first, it was a hobby, fueled by her interest in technology and a desire to see what she could do with it. From there it turned into a side hustle (a part time job on the side) until now, she works at home running her own business. And a big part of her heart is to help black women see that there really ARE people like them out there who are becoming successful building their own businesses and brands. LaShanda is an example to inspire you to take that first step. What are you waiting for? Come listen to LaShanda’s story and let it spark a dream inside of you.

The success of your business depends on the company you keep.

That is one of LaShanda Henry’s favorite statements. It’s a lesson she’s learned over the years as she turned an interest into a hobby, a hobby into a side hustle, and that side hustle into her own full time, work from home business. What it means practically is that she had to find women like herself who were eager to become successful doing their own thing, building a business that could support them and take care of their families. And she’s done exactly that. Now she runs www.SistaSense.com and has created an online community for Black Business Women at http://network.mybbwo.com/ . What company are you keeping? HBW 001: You Can’t Get Rich When You’re Angry: A Conversation with Dr. Venus Opal Reese

October 5, 2015 | By Rosetta |

happy black woman podcast_feat _Dr. Venus Opal Reese_capitals_72dpi

Get ready for a wonderful ride into the depths of inspiration and courage. You’re about to meet Dr. Venus Opal Reese, a powerfully impactful black woman who is no stranger to hardship OR success. Dr. Venus was an abandoned teen, left on the streets to fend for herself when a heroic teacher at her school took her in and believed in her, setting her on a new course that would change the lives of hundreds, even thousands of women in the world today. In this episode you’re going to hear Dr. Venus’ story, how she views the situations black women face today, and what she is called to do to empower and equip those women for greatness.

You’ve been told a lie.

Dr. Venus strongly believes that black women today are living out a lie that’s been foisted on them for many years. They’ve played out the role of workhorse when their destiny is actually something far greater. Her conviction is that black women need to change the story they’re telling themselves, the stories that go on in their own minds so they can liberate themselves from the drudgery of the past and break into a life of freedom, personally and financially. You can’t get rich when you’re angry.

That’s one of Dr. Venus Opal Reese’s core beliefs. She believes that love, peace, and the ability to build a vast financial storehouse all flow from the same place, so those negative emotions like hatred, jealousy, bitterness, and anger will block you receiving the money that is meant to be yours. What is the cure? You’ve got to experience healing in your heart before anything else. You’ve got to learn how to let the past go so you can move beyond it and experience the freedom that is your birthright. Pay attention to this episode, ladies. Dr. Venus has a lot to share that will help you throw off your chains, if you will let her.

Don’t be afraid to set amazingly lofty goals for yourself.

It’s that same fear that will hold you back from accomplishing them, so you ‘ve got to start by being willing to name the goal. Write it down. Speak it out loud. Do what it takes to convince yourself that the years of not believing in yourself ARE NOT GOING TO hold you back from taking hold of that goal. Once you’ve done that, you’re ready to begin the practical steps of planning how you’re going to achieve that goal. But be careful, goals are not predictions, they are just plans. As you diligently work toward the accomplishment of your goal, remain flexible to receive other blessings you didn’t even know to dream about. Rosetta’s move from working as a successful nonprofit professional to becoming an entrepreneur, speaker, and coach.

Rosetta had a pretty comfortable job. She was paid well. Everything was going her way. But something happened she didn’t expect. People began inviting her to speak at their companies and events, asking her to share the wisdom she’d learned in her comfortable job. So Rosetta started traveling, speaking, experiencing the new things you can only experience when you’re on the road traveling the globe. That’s when she began to realize that the 9 to 5 corporate role she was in was actually very limiting. That was the first time she began to think that maybe she could step out of that comfortable job and begin a life of her own making. The story is incredible, and you can hear the rest of it on this episode of the podcast.

Rosetta’s year of liberation…

It was 2010 when all the pieces came together and Rosetta made her fateful decision. She quit her corporate job in the nonprofit sector and began her entrepreneurial career. The rest is history. Rosetta has traveled the world seeing sights she never thought she’d see and meeting people and having opportunities that she never dreamed. Her story is one of inspiration, hope, and courage.
